Roadmap to Becoming a Cybersecurity Expert: A Step-by-Step Guide for Non-Technical Backgrounds

Understanding Cybersecurity: An Overview

Cybersecurity refers to the practice of protecting systems, networks, and programs from digital attacks, ultimately aiming to safeguard sensitive information and maintain data integrity. In our increasingly interconnected world, the importance of cybersecurity cannot be overstated. With the proliferation of Internet of Things (IoT) devices, cloud computing, and remote work, enterprises face an ever-evolving landscape of threats, including malware, phishing, ransomware, and data breaches. This necessitates a proactive approach to securing both organizational and personal data.

The field of cybersecurity is multifaceted, encompassing various roles that cater to different aspects of security. Professionals in this domain can specialize in areas such as information security, ethics in hacking, risk assessment, compliance, and incident response. For instance, information security analysts focus on protecting organizations’ systems by monitoring networks for vulnerabilities and implementing security measures. Others, such as penetration testers, simulate attacks to evaluate the robustness of security systems and identify areas for improvement. This indicates that cybersecurity is not just limited to technical expertise; it also requires strategic thinking and awareness of ethical considerations.

Organizations across various sectors actively seek cybersecurity professionals to fortify their defenses. This demand is driven by the increasing volume of cyber threats that target confidential information and critical infrastructures. The consequences of inadequate cybersecurity measures can be catastrophic, leading to financial loss, reputational damage, and legal repercussions. Therefore, the presence of skilled cybersecurity professionals is vital to develop robust defenses against such threats, making this sector not only essential for the protection of information but also a promising career avenue for individuals from non-technical backgrounds.

Basic Certifications to Get Started

For individuals seeking to transition into the field of cybersecurity, obtaining certain entry-level certifications is a crucial first step. These certifications not only enhance one’s understanding of core concepts but also significantly improve employability within the industry. Among the most recognized certifications for beginners is the CompTIA Security+ certification. This foundational credential validates the knowledge required for implementing security measures and managing risk, covering essential topics such as network security, compliance, operational security, and threats and vulnerabilities. For non-technical individuals, the Security+ certification serves as an accessible introduction to the fundamental principles of cybersecurity.

Another noteworthy certification is the Certified Ethical Hacker (CEH). While it may appear daunting, the CEH is designed to provide a clear understanding of ethical hacking and penetration testing methodologies. This certification empowers candidates to think like a hacker, allowing them to identify and remediate vulnerabilities in systems, which is increasingly critical in today’s cyber landscape. Achieving CEH can be immensely beneficial for non-technical professionals aiming to grasp the proactive measures taken against cyber threats.

Additionally, aspiring cybersecurity experts may consider obtaining certifications such as the CompTIA Cybersecurity Analyst (CySA+) and the CompTIA PenTest+. The CySA+ focuses on behavioral analytics to identify and combat malware, while the PenTest+ is centered around penetration testing and vulnerability assessment. Both certifications contribute foundational skills necessary for a career in cybersecurity.

These basic certifications create a solid stepping stone for individuals, regardless of their previous experience, paving the way for deeper exploration into specialized areas of cybersecurity. As one advances, obtaining more advanced certifications like CISSP or CISM may further solidify expertise and career opportunities in this ever-evolving field. Building a robust foundational knowledge through certifications is essential for a successful journey into cybersecurity.

Building Technical Skills: An Introductory Guide

To embark on a successful journey in cybersecurity, acquiring a solid foundation in technical skills is essential, particularly for individuals hailing from non-technical backgrounds. Building such skills may seem daunting; however, various resources are available to facilitate this learning process. The key areas to focus on include networking basics, understanding operating systems, and familiarity with security protocols.

Firstly, gaining knowledge in networking basics is paramount. Understanding how different devices communicate within a network, including concepts such as IP addresses, subnets, and routing, lays the groundwork for grasping more advanced cybersecurity concepts. Numerous online platforms such as Coursera, Udemy, and Khan Academy offer courses specifically designed to introduce learners to networking principles. Engaging with these resources can significantly bolster one’s comprehension of network security and its importance within the cybersecurity realm.

Secondly, familiarity with operating systems is a crucial aspect in the field of cybersecurity. An adept cybersecurity expert must be comfortable navigating different operating systems, particularly those widely used in the enterprise environment, such as Windows, Linux, and macOS. There are numerous tutorials and courses available through platforms such as Pluralsight and LinkedIn Learning, which allow individuals to learn the intricacies of various operating systems. Understanding file systems, user permissions, and system commands enhances one’s ability to protect and harden these environments against potential attacks.

Lastly, becoming acquainted with essential security protocols is integral to building technical skills in cybersecurity. Knowledge of protocols such as HTTPS, SSL/TLS, and VPN can significantly elevate one’s ability to implement and enforce security measures. There are excellent free resources available, including YouTube channels, blogs, and even forums that provide insights into these protocols. By utilizing these diverse online learning tools, individuals can acquire the necessary skills to thrive in the cybersecurity landscape.

Gaining Practical Experience: Internships and Labs

One of the most effective avenues for transitioning into the realm of cybersecurity, particularly for individuals from non-technical backgrounds, is through practical experience gained via internships and specialized training labs. These opportunities provide a foundational understanding of cybersecurity principles while facilitating the acquisition of hands-on skills that are imperative in this rapidly evolving field.

Internships are an excellent starting point for aspiring cybersecurity professionals. They allow individuals to work closely with seasoned experts, providing insights into day-to-day operations and strategic decision-making within organizations. Interns often engage in tasks such as network monitoring, incident response, and vulnerability assessments, all of which are crucial for developing competent skills. Many organizations offer structured internship programs that emphasize mentorship, thereby enhancing the learning experience.

In addition to internships, volunteering for cybersecurity-related initiatives can significantly enhance practical knowledge. Nonprofits, educational institutions, and even local businesses may offer opportunities to assist in securing their digital environments. Contributing to such projects not only enriches one’s experience but also expands professional networks, which can prove beneficial in securing future employment.

Moreover, participating in training labs dedicated to cybersecurity can significantly bolster practical skills. These labs often simulate real-world environments where individuals can test and refine their analytical abilities. Engaging in Capture The Flag (CTF) challenges is particularly effective in sharpening critical thinking and problem-solving capabilities. CTF competitions require participants to solve security-related puzzles, which mirror real-world vulnerabilities and attack vectors, thereby preparing candidates for authentic scenarios they might encounter in the field.

Through a combination of internships, volunteer work, and participation in training labs, individuals can build the practical experience necessary to succeed in cybersecurity. By immersing oneself in genuine situations and challenges, aspiring cybersecurity experts can better position themselves for a rewarding career in this essential industry.

Exploring Specializations within Cybersecurity

Cybersecurity is a multifaceted field that encompasses various specializations catering to different interests and skill sets. For those with a non-technical background, understanding these specializations is essential for navigating their career trajectory within the cybersecurity domain. Penetration testing, incident response, and security compliance are among the most prominent areas one can explore.

Penetration testing, often referred to as ethical hacking, involves simulating cyber attacks to identify vulnerabilities in an organization’s systems. Aspiring penetration testers need to hone their analytical skills and develop a strong understanding of how systems operate. Although this field is technical, non-technical professionals can build a foundation by engaging in relevant certifications such as the Certified Ethical Hacker (CEH) or through courses that offer practical experience in cybersecurity tools and methodologies.

Another crucial area within cybersecurity is incident response, which focuses on minimizing damage following a security breach. Professionals in incident response need to have strong problem-solving capabilities and the ability to act swiftly under pressure. Non-technical individuals can transition into this specialization through roles in management or coordination, without requiring deep technical expertise. Gaining knowledge through certifications such as the Certified Incident Handler (GCIH) can equip these professionals with the necessary skills for effective incident handling.

Lastly, security compliance involves ensuring that businesses adhere to relevant security policies, laws, and regulations. This specialization appeals to those with an interest in law, policy, or governance. Professionals in security compliance should develop a thorough understanding of regulations such as GDPR or HIPAA, which govern data protection. For non-technical individuals, certifications like Certified Information Systems Auditor (CISA) or Certified Information Systems Security Professional (CISSP) can provide essential credentials to succeed in this area.

By understanding these various specializations, non-technical professionals can align their interests and skills with specific niches in cybersecurity, paving the way for a fulfilling career in this dynamic field.

Crafting Your Career Path: From Entry-Level to Expert

Embarking on a career in cybersecurity can be particularly daunting for individuals coming from non-technical backgrounds. However, with strategic planning and determination, it is entirely feasible to ascend from entry-level positions to expert roles within this field. Understanding the various pathways available is crucial to forming a successful career trajectory.

Initially, it’s essential to identify entry-level roles, such as security analyst, IT technician, or help desk support, which often require only foundational knowledge in technology and security protocols. These positions provide valuable insight into the workings of digital security and the management of information systems. Aspiring professionals can complement on-the-job experience with certifications from recognized organizations—such as CompTIA Security+, Certified Ethical Hacker, or Certified Information Systems Security Professional—each of which enhances both knowledge and employability.

Moreover, mentorship plays a pivotal role in career development within cybersecurity. Seeking guidance from established professionals helps newcomers navigate challenges and set realistic goals. Engaging in networking opportunities, whether through conferences, online forums, or local meet-ups, can lead to meaningful connections and insight into the industry’s best practices and potential career advancements.

In terms of setting career goals, it is prudent to follow the SMART criteria: goals should be Specific, Measurable, Achievable, Relevant, and Time-bound. For instance, setting a goal to achieve a specific certification within six months or to learn a new programming language can provide clear direction. As skills advance, opportunities for growth can expand towards higher roles, including security architect or chief information security officer.

Ultimately, the path from entry-level roles to expertise in cybersecurity is defined by continuous learning, proactive networking, and setting achievable milestones. The cybersecurity landscape is ever-evolving, and remaining adaptable ensures sustained career advancement in this dynamic field.
